Overview of the 63006 Bearing
The 63006 bearing is part of the 6300 series, which comprises deep groove ball bearings. These bearings are characterized by their simple design, easy maintenance, and durability under various operating conditions. The “6” in the name signifies that it belongs to the 6000 series, with the last digits denoting specific features pertaining to size and design.
In the case of the 63006 bearing, its dimensions are as follows - Inner Diameter (ID) 30 mm - Outer Diameter (OD) 55 mm - Width (W) 25 mm
This specific configuration enables the 63006 bearing to support both radial and axial loads, making it suitable for a variety of applications.
Detailed Specifications
The 63006 bearing features a deep groove structure that aids in accommodating misalignments and offering high-speed capabilities. Its design includes an inner and outer ring with a complement of steel balls in between, which facilitate the reduction of friction between moving parts.
1. Load Capacity The 63006 bearing is capable of handling moderate radial loads, with a dynamic load rating of approximately 14,300 N and a static load rating of around 7,750 N. This load-bearing capacity is essential in applications where there are significant radial forces at play.
2. Speed Rating The maximum operating speed of the 63006 bearing depends on the specific lubricant used; however, it generally can operate efficiently at speeds of up to 8,000 revolutions per minute (RPM). This makes it an excellent choice for applications that require high-speed rotation.
3. Materials Typically manufactured from high-quality steel, the 63006 bearing is designed for durability and longevity. Some variants are made with stainless steel for specific environments where corrosion resistance is necessary.
4. Lubrication The bearing can be lubricated either with grease or oil, which is essential for minimizing friction and wear. Proper lubrication enhances the life expectancy of the bearing, ensuring it operates efficiently over long periods.
Applications of the 63006 Bearing
The versatility of the 63006 bearing allows it to be used in various applications across multiple industries. Some common uses include
- Electric Motors These bearings are critical in electric motors, providing smooth operation and reducing wear and tear on motor components. - Automobiles The automotive sector uses the 63006 bearing in various applications, including wheels, gears, and transmissions. - Industrial Machinery Many machines utilize the 63006 bearing in their rotating parts, benefiting from its reliability and load capacity. - Agricultural Equipment The bearing is also suitable for use in agricultural machinery, which often operates under tough conditions.
